The RT8300 is a high-performance LED backlight driver designed for LCD panels. It integrates a boost converter and multiple current sinks to provide a regulated current to the LEDs. This device is optimized for small to medium-sized LCD panels used in notebooks, monitors, and portable devices.

Features:
- High Efficiency Boost Converter: Maximizes power efficiency for longer battery life.
- Multiple Current Sinks: Enables uniform brightness across the display.
- Wide Input Voltage Range: Accommodates various power sources.
- PWM Dimming Control: Provides precise brightness adjustment.
- Over-Voltage Protection (OVP): Protects the device and the LEDs from damage.
- Over-Current Protection (OCP): Prevents excessive current flow.
- Short-Circuit Protection (SCP): Safeguards against short circuits.
- Open-LED Protection: Detects and protects against open LED strings.
- Available in a compact package: Saves board space.

Additional Details:
The RT8300 employs a high-efficiency boost converter to generate the necessary voltage for driving the LED strings. The multiple current sinks regulate the current flowing through each LED string, ensuring uniform brightness. PWM dimming control enables precise adjustment of the display brightness. The device integrates comprehensive protection features, including over-voltage protection, over-current protection, short-circuit protection, and open-LED protection, to ensure robust operation and protect the device and the LEDs from damage.
